VAT16.1 Who qualifies?

Overseas doctors or dentists who wish to work in the UK may undertake periods of clinical attachments or dental observation posts in order to familiarise themselves with UK working practices. These clinical attachments and dental observation posts are unpaid and involve observation only and not treatment of patients.

Overseas doctors and dentists can apply for leave to enter to undertake clinical attachment or dental observation posts. However, doctors who are already in the UK on leave to take the PLAB test, or on leave as postgraduate doctors, dentists and trainee general practitioners, can undertake clinical attachments or dental observation posts under their existing leave. They will only have to apply separately under the specific rules on clinical attachments or dental observation posts where their period of existing leave (to take the PLAB Test or as a postgraduate doctor/dentist/trainee general practitioner) is due to expire before the end of the clinical attachment or dental observation post.
